Selecting the Perfect Metal for Your Loved One's Jewelry
When picking out jewellery for a loved one, picking the right metal can greatly improve the meaning and appeal of the gift. Each metal features its own meaning and visual appeal, impacting the recipient's perception. For instance, yellow gold emanates warmth and timeless elegance, making it a popular choice for romantic gifts. White gold, with its sleek contemporary sheen, offers a modern touch, source attracting those with a taste for sophistication.
Platinum, known for its durability and rarity, symbolizes enduring love, perfect for a lasting commitment. Alternatively, silver provides a flexible and budget-friendly option, often chosen for its lustrous appearance and versatility.
In choosing the metal, it is necessary to think about the person's lifestyle and skin sensitivity, as some may prefer hypoallergenic materials. Wearability and Comfort
Proper sizing importance goes beyond simple measurements; it has a direct effect on comfort and wearability. Regarding rings and bracelets, securing the proper fit is vital. A ring that's overly tight can create discomfort and limit blood circulation, whereas one that's too loose may slip off and get lost. Similarly, bracelets must allow for easy movement without pinching or sliding excessively. The correct size ensures that the jewellery can be worn all day long without discomfort, improving the complete experience. How Do I Determine My Partner's Ring Size Discreetly?
To determine a partner's ring size secretly, you may draw around the inside of a ring they already wear or use a piece of string to measure their finger, then compare it to a ring size chart.

What if My Partner Has Allergies to Certain Metals?
When your partner has allergies to certain metals, it is important to pick hypoallergenic materials like titanium, surgical stainless steel, or gold vermeil. Knowing about their sensitivities guarantees thoughtful gift-giving while prioritizing comfort and safety.
